    "content": "constituency is a delivery unit. Under the National Government Coordination Act, section 14, a constituency has been made a service delivery unit. This particular section has not been nullified, nor has it been declared unconstitutional. So, we, as Members of Parliament, wondered how the High Court could declare that the constituency is just merely an electoral unit and yet, we know that there is an Act of Parliament which clearly states that a constituency is a service delivery unit. It is not meant to be for voting purposes only."
